Archive for 12月 3rd, 2011

  1. Hello, C# World!

    Posted on 12月 3rd, 2011 by cx20

    C#

    C# はマイクロソフトが .NET Framework 環境向けに作成したオブジェクト指向プログラミング言語である。当初は COOL となるはずだったが、他の製品で使われている為に変更された。「#」は「++++」を表すとの説がある。
    基本的には Windows 向けの言語だが、UNIX 環境向けの .NET Framework 互換プロジェクト「Mono」により他の OS でも動作できるようになってきている。

    ソースコード

    using System;
     
    class Hello 
    {
        static void Main( string[] args ) 
        {
            Console.WriteLine( "Hello, C# World!" );
        }
    }

    コンパイル&実行方法(Mono)

    $ mcs Hello.cs
    $ mono Hello.exe

    コンパイル&実行方法(.NET Framework)

    C:¥> csc Hello.cs
    C:¥> Hello

    実行結果

    Hello, C# World!